You can tune into the preset stations simply by selecting
the preset station groups and numbers.
1
Set the operation mode selector to TV/AV.
2
Press FMlXM repeatedly to select FM as the
input source.
"FM" appears in the front panel display.
4
Press ENTRY
~ (L:::../'9')
to select the desired
preset station number (1 to 8).
The preset station group and number appear in the
front panel display together with the station band and
frequency.
